Package: release.debian.org Severity: normal User: release.debian....@packages.debian.org Usertags: unblock X-Debbugs-Cc: libdatetime-timezone-p...@packages.debian.org, debian-p...@lists.debian.org Control: affects -1 + src:libdatetime-timezone-perl
-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A512 Please unblock package libdatetime-timezone-perl: I've uploaded libdatetime-timezone-perl/1:2.59-1+2023b to unstable. This is the new upstream release which contains the contents of the Olson DB version 2023b. tzdata changes: 2023a Egypt now uses DST again, from April through October. This year Morocco springs forward April 23, not April 30. Palestine delays the start of DST this year. Much of Greenland still uses DST from 2024 on. 2023b Lebanon delays the start of DST this year. The upload does not contain any other relevant changes (neither upstream nor in packaging). Tests during build and autopkgtest pass, no other observations … I'm attaching a manually stripped down debdiff against 1:2.56-1+2022g in testing. unblock libdatetime-timezone-perl/1:2.59-1+2023b Thanks in advance, gregor -----BEGIN PGP SIGNATURE----- iQKTBAEBCgB9FiEE0eExbpOnYKgQTYX6uzpoAYZJqgYFAmQdxt5fFIAAAAAALgAo aXNzdWVyLWZwckBub3RhdGlvbnMub3BlbnBncC5maWZ0aGhvcnNlbWFuLm5ldEQx RTEzMTZFOTNBNzYwQTgxMDREODVGQUJCM0E2ODAxODY0OUFBMDYACgkQuzpoAYZJ qgaYgg/+I5kMFw5qi6zCsDI0g4USkiVFRPlJN1ey+1GPJ2D9hv0YNdAyOfRmvrRq /EY0LVva+ARiIt1MabDRk4BSBnsPzSW+32a7mmrmDjYG/lXoUe5LTjEu2lhoegZ0 YN4gs1t9u2zoeHz+Gfemf1ozhesF34LTNYbI9IzvJLust/bBFtZYJNQULg5pGBmY b0jotCDWQAGA5bIrhJkm7l5eP3G0v/o1//nttmu5j1uCCerQwXQ/UtZTExzHOc8R 8eyqNnQAl6ldsOMfp9eAjr1//XbWdD/XMeUMA1XApWzdvJ6aAULTkva6o8Z0nXJy rlE+GeG3p/khtLC0HhUmE7Dwn/tgSd6UDuGUH4ttAAf11We3cmvYoCuwNW7uGbY7 fU9JPHanRl24MCL2rvHcCKBIt+zyS9s2yIXM8GAc1KixR/HoUpraszLwLQ7+h8Dy X5PBVSdH+UnYwXbd6o6A18ACkaJcprZ1Tj+yhwa7fm9/4oZdGeQSO/aePJ2GFLtU PqpN7nLFXuXj1ayKaVnIt3f7JgOrhTzSRsIABJbuvcpcFxNasXof9Dopm3qxS0oc ZzDkdGvEqrrBu4s9eLIgdpqc7Fs60XJYmZoahcMMADRoKNsx6P//kGiaaG1MNrEJ zVUjlvBCSi4d7t9Anx364C+W5cZjL4P0I5M9W08BZJ23WXtHnaM= =rndO -----END PGP SIGNATURE-----
diff -Nru libdatetime-timezone-perl-2.56/Changes libdatetime-timezone-perl-2.59/Changes --- libdatetime-timezone-perl-2.56/Changes 2022-10-29 05:14:21.000000000 +0200 +++ libdatetime-timezone-perl-2.59/Changes 2023-03-24 05:36:13.000000000 +0100 @@ -1,3 +1,21 @@ +2.59 2023-03-23 + +- This release is based on version 2023b of the Olson database. This release + includes contemporary changes for Lebanon. + + +2.58 2023-03-22 + +- This release is based on version 2023a of the Olson database. This release + includes contemporary changes for Egypt, Greenland, Morocco, and Palestine. + + +2.57 2022-12-13 + +- This release is based on version 2022g of the Olson database. This release + includes contemporary changes for Greenland and Mexico. + + 2.56 2022-10-28 - This release is based on version 2022f of the Olson database. This release diff -Nru libdatetime-timezone-perl-2.56/LICENSE libdatetime-timezone-perl-2.59/LICENSE --- libdatetime-timezone-perl-2.56/LICENSE 2022-10-29 05:14:21.000000000 +0200 +++ libdatetime-timezone-perl-2.59/LICENSE 2023-03-24 05:36:13.000000000 +0100 @@ -1,4 +1,4 @@ -This software is copyright (c) 2022 by Dave Rolsky. +This software is copyright (c) 2023 by Dave Rolsky. This is free software; you can redistribute it and/or modify it under the same terms as the Perl 5 programming language system itself. @@ -12,7 +12,7 @@ --- The GNU General Public License, Version 1, February 1989 --- -This software is Copyright (c) 2022 by Dave Rolsky. +This software is Copyright (c) 2023 by Dave Rolsky. This is free software, licensed under: @@ -272,7 +272,7 @@ --- The Artistic License 1.0 --- -This software is Copyright (c) 2022 by Dave Rolsky. +This software is Copyright (c) 2023 by Dave Rolsky. This is free software, licensed under: diff -Nru libdatetime-timezone-perl-2.56/MANIFEST libdatetime-timezone-perl-2.59/MANIFEST diff -Nru libdatetime-timezone-perl-2.56/debian/changelog libdatetime-timezone-perl-2.59/debian/changelog --- libdatetime-timezone-perl-2.56/debian/changelog 2022-11-30 18:03:44.000000000 +0100 +++ libdatetime-timezone-perl-2.59/debian/changelog 2023-03-24 16:38:06.000000000 +0100 @@ -1,3 +1,20 @@ +libdatetime-timezone-perl (1:2.59-1+2023b) unstable; urgency=medium + + * Import upstream version 2.59. + The 2.57 release was based on version 2022g of the Olson database. + It includes contemporary changes for Greenland and Mexico (already + present in 1:2.56-1+2022g). + The 2.58 release was based on version 2023a of the Olson database. + It includes contemporary changes for Egypt, Greenland, Morocco, and + Palestine. + This release (2.59) is based on version 2023b of the Olson database. + It includes contemporary changes for Lebanon. + * Drop debian/patches/olson-2022g. Version 2022g was included in 2.57. + * Update years of upstream and packaging copyright. + * Declare compliance with Debian Policy 4.6.2. + + -- gregor herrmann <gre...@debian.org> Fri, 24 Mar 2023 16:38:06 +0100 + libdatetime-timezone-perl (1:2.56-1+2022g) unstable; urgency=high * Update data to Olson database version 2022g. This update contains diff -Nru libdatetime-timezone-perl-2.56/debian/control libdatetime-timezone-perl-2.59/debian/control --- libdatetime-timezone-perl-2.56/debian/control 2022-11-30 18:03:44.000000000 +0100 +++ libdatetime-timezone-perl-2.59/debian/control 2023-03-24 16:38:06.000000000 +0100 @@ -19,7 +19,7 @@ libtest-taint-perl <!nocheck>, libtry-tiny-perl <!nocheck>, perl -Standards-Version: 4.6.1 +Standards-Version: 4.6.2 Vcs-Browser: https://salsa.debian.org/perl-team/modules/packages/libdatetime-timezone-perl Vcs-Git: https://salsa.debian.org/perl-team/modules/packages/libdatetime-timezone-perl.git Homepage: http://datetime.perl.org/ diff -Nru libdatetime-timezone-perl-2.56/debian/copyright libdatetime-timezone-perl-2.59/debian/copyright --- libdatetime-timezone-perl-2.56/debian/copyright 2022-11-30 18:03:44.000000000 +0100 +++ libdatetime-timezone-perl-2.59/debian/copyright 2023-03-24 16:38:06.000000000 +0100 @@ -4,7 +4,7 @@ Source: https://metacpan.org/release/DateTime-TimeZone Files: * -Copyright: 2022, David Rolsky <auta...@urth.org> +Copyright: 2023, David Rolsky <auta...@urth.org> License: Artistic or GPL-1+ Files: debian/* @@ -12,7 +12,7 @@ 2008, Damyan Ivanov <d...@debian.org> 2008, Krzysztof Krzyżaniak (eloy) <e...@debian.org> 2009-2011, Jonathan Yu <jaw...@cpan.org> - 2009-2022, gregor herrmann <gre...@debian.org> + 2009-2023, gregor herrmann <gre...@debian.org> 2011, Nicholas Bamber <nicho...@periapt.co.uk> License: Artistic or GPL-1+ diff -Nru libdatetime-timezone-perl-2.56/debian/patches/series libdatetime-timezone-perl-2.59/debian/patches/series --- libdatetime-timezone-perl-2.56/debian/patches/series 2022-11-30 18:03:44.000000000 +0100 +++ libdatetime-timezone-perl-2.59/debian/patches/series 1970-01-01 01:00:00.000000000 +0100 @@ -1 +0,0 @@ -olson-2022g diff -Nru libdatetime-timezone-perl-2.56/lib/DateTime/TimeZone/Africa/Abidjan.pm libdatetime-timezone-perl-2.59/lib/DateTime/TimeZone/Africa/Abidjan.pm --- libdatetime-timezone-perl-2.56/lib/DateTime/TimeZone/Africa/Abidjan.pm 2022-10-29 05:14:21.000000000 +0200 +++ libdatetime-timezone-perl-2.59/lib/DateTime/TimeZone/Africa/Abidjan.pm 2023-03-24 05:36:13.000000000 +0100 @@ -3,7 +3,7 @@ # DateTime::TimeZone module distribution in the tools/ directory # -# Generated from /tmp/ehRi0awH48/africa. Olson data version 2022f +# Generated from /tmp/D3ET7029pk/africa. Olson data version 2023b # # Do not edit this file directly. # @@ -13,7 +13,7 @@ use warnings; use namespace::autoclean; -our $VERSION = '2.56'; +our $VERSION = '2.59'; use Class::Singleton 1.03; use DateTime::TimeZone; @@ -43,11 +43,11 @@ ], ]; -sub olson_version {'2022f'} +sub olson_version {'2023b'} sub has_dst_changes {0} -sub _max_year {2032} +sub _max_year {2033} sub _new_instance { return shift->_init( @_, spans => $spans ); diff -Nru libdatetime-timezone-perl-2.56/lib/DateTime/TimeZone/Africa/Algiers.pm libdatetime-timezone-perl-2.59/lib/DateTime/TimeZone/Africa/Algiers.pm diff -Nru libdatetime-timezone-perl-2.56/lib/DateTime/TimeZone/Asia/Beirut.pm libdatetime-timezone-perl-2.59/lib/DateTime/TimeZone/Asia/Beirut.pm --- libdatetime-timezone-perl-2.56/lib/DateTime/TimeZone/Asia/Beirut.pm 2022-10-29 05:14:21.000000000 +0200 +++ libdatetime-timezone-perl-2.59/lib/DateTime/TimeZone/Asia/Beirut.pm 2023-03-24 05:36:13.000000000 +0100 @@ -3,7 +3,7 @@ # DateTime::TimeZone module distribution in the tools/ directory # -# Generated from /tmp/ehRi0awH48/asia. Olson data version 2022f +# Generated from /tmp/D3ET7029pk/asia. Olson data version 2023b # # Do not edit this file directly. # @@ -13,7 +13,7 @@ use warnings; use namespace::autoclean; -our $VERSION = '2.56'; +our $VERSION = '2.59'; use Class::Singleton 1.03; use DateTime::TimeZone; @@ -1024,17 +1024,17 @@ ], [ 63802760400, # utc_start 2022-10-29 21:00:00 (Sat) -63815464800, # utc_end 2023-03-25 22:00:00 (Sat) +63817711200, # utc_end 2023-04-20 22:00:00 (Thu) 63802767600, # local_start 2022-10-29 23:00:00 (Sat) -63815472000, # local_end 2023-03-26 00:00:00 (Sun) +63817718400, # local_end 2023-04-21 00:00:00 (Fri) 7200, 0, 'EET', ], [ -63815464800, # utc_start 2023-03-25 22:00:00 (Sat) +63817711200, # utc_start 2023-04-20 22:00:00 (Thu) 63834210000, # utc_end 2023-10-28 21:00:00 (Sat) -63815475600, # local_start 2023-03-26 01:00:00 (Sun) +63817722000, # local_start 2023-04-21 01:00:00 (Fri) 63834220800, # local_end 2023-10-29 00:00:00 (Sun) 10800, 1, @@ -1220,13 +1220,31 @@ 1, 'EEST', ], + [ +64149915600, # utc_start 2033-10-29 21:00:00 (Sat) +64162620000, # utc_end 2034-03-25 22:00:00 (Sat) +64149922800, # local_start 2033-10-29 23:00:00 (Sat) +64162627200, # local_end 2034-03-26 00:00:00 (Sun) +7200, +0, +'EET', + ], + [ +64162620000, # utc_start 2034-03-25 22:00:00 (Sat) +64181365200, # utc_end 2034-10-28 21:00:00 (Sat) +64162630800, # local_start 2034-03-26 01:00:00 (Sun) +64181376000, # local_end 2034-10-29 00:00:00 (Sun) +10800, +1, +'EEST', + ], ]; -sub olson_version {'2022f'} +sub olson_version {'2023b'} -sub has_dst_changes {66} +sub has_dst_changes {67} -sub _max_year {2032} +sub _max_year {2033} sub _new_instance { return shift->_init( @_, spans => $spans ); @@ -1275,24 +1293,24 @@ my $rules = [ bless( { 'at' => '0:00', - 'from' => '1993', - 'in' => 'Mar', - 'letter' => 'S', + 'from' => '1999', + 'in' => 'Oct', + 'letter' => '', 'name' => 'Lebanon', - 'offset_from_std' => 3600, + 'offset_from_std' => 0, 'on' => 'lastSun', - 'save' => '1:00', + 'save' => '0', 'to' => 'max' }, 'DateTime::TimeZone::OlsonDB::Rule' ), bless( { 'at' => '0:00', - 'from' => '1999', - 'in' => 'Oct', - 'letter' => '', + 'from' => '2024', + 'in' => 'Mar', + 'letter' => 'S', 'name' => 'Lebanon', - 'offset_from_std' => 0, + 'offset_from_std' => 3600, 'on' => 'lastSun', - 'save' => '0', + 'save' => '1:00', 'to' => 'max' }, 'DateTime::TimeZone::OlsonDB::Rule' ) ]